Ball joint replacement involves removing worn or damaged spherical bearings connecting a vehicle’s control arms to the steering knuckles. The labor and parts required impact the total expenditure. Various factors, such as vehicle make and model, part quality, and geographical location, influence the final cost. A simple example would be the need for replacement on a standard sedan versus a heavy-duty truck, leading to a disparity in both parts and labor expenses.

Maintaining functional ball joints is crucial for vehicle safety and handling. Worn ball joints can cause instability, excessive tire wear, and potentially lead to suspension failure. Regular inspection and timely replacement prevent more extensive and costly repairs. Historically, ball joint maintenance was often overlooked, but modern vehicle safety standards and increased awareness of suspension system health have elevated its importance.

Determining the appropriate quantity of cooked rice for canine consumption depends on several factors. These include the dog’s size, age, activity level, and overall health status. For example, a small breed dog with a sedentary lifestyle requires a significantly smaller serving compared to a large, active breed.

Incorporating rice into a dog’s diet can offer several potential advantages. It serves as a bland, easily digestible carbohydrate source, often recommended during periods of gastrointestinal upset. Furthermore, rice can be a valuable component of homemade diets formulated under veterinary guidance, providing essential energy and fiber. Historically, rice has been used in canine diets as a binding agent during episodes of diarrhea.

The expenditure associated with rectifying a fluid expulsion from an automotive gearbox can fluctuate significantly based on several contributing factors. These include the location and severity of the seepage, the vehicle’s make and model, and the prevailing labor rates in a particular geographic region. Accurately assessing the source and magnitude of the efflux is crucial in determining the overall cost.

Addressing this issue promptly offers numerous advantages, primarily preventing extensive damage to the transmission system. A diminished fluid level can lead to overheating, component wear, and ultimately, complete transmission failure, resulting in far more substantial repair bills. Historically, neglecting minor seepages often escalated into major mechanical problems, highlighting the importance of timely intervention.
